I'm in Ontario. PAL and RPAL issued today. Seems the process has changed slightly from the original post but the overall idea remains the same. I really appreciate it!
Here's my timeline:
July 9/10, 2016
- CFSC and CRFSC courses
July 27, 2016
- Incomplete PAL application received by RCMP
August 8, 2016
- Application showing online as "Initial processing, you have been contacted for more info"
August 16, 2016
- Received letter about missing CFSC and CRFSC proof
August 30, 2016
- Received CFSC and CRFSC from FSESO by email
- Faxed to RCMP
August 31, 2016
- Application showing online as "Completed initial processing. In progress"
- I called about doing an interview, was informed they don't do applicant interviews anymore and only call one reference if you apply for RPAL
- One reference called in
- Application now showing online as "Application has been processed and license has been issued."
- Called CFO and asked for license number

Just a refresher:
July 9th
Took CFSC
After reading this sticky and waiting 4 weeks decided to send in my PAL application in without course report that I had still not received.
August 1st
Sent in PAL application.
August 5th
Received in Miramichi (so starts 28 day mandatory wait period).
August 27
Received CFSC course report via email.
August 28
Faxed in course report along with letter I had received from RCMP regarding report missing.
August 29
Online update went from "processing" and "will be contacted regarding missing information" to "Completed initial processing and is in progress"
August 30 (Today)
Called in to see if I needed to be interviewed or either of my references and was told PAL was approved and just waiting out the 28 day mandatory wait period after which it will be issued and printed and that since it is non-restricted references do not need to be called.
That being said, Friday Sept 2 will be 28 days!
If I had waited til I had got my CFSC report before sending in my PAL application I would be looking at at least another month and into October before getting my Pal! Big time saver and just wanted to say thank you very much!!! Last update will be when I have PAL in hand!![]()
